United Kingdom, April 24 -- Elizabeth Banks has been told she "can't direct men" because they wouldn't "follow" her on set.
The 52-year-old actress and filmmaker has opened up about the misogyny she has faced in Hollywood, despite working with the likes of Ray Liotta in 2023's Cocaine Bear.
Appearing on The Kelly Clarkson Show, she said: "I was literally told because I direct films that, 'You can't direct men. They won't follow you'.
"And then I directed Ray Liotta, who played Henry Hill in Goodfellas, and I think I nailed it. Check the list off. It's all good."
